Creating metal surfaces

 wrote this short text some time ago to help people when they were creating metal surfaces and thought it could do with being reposted here. I've also added a section on reflections at the end so without further ado...

Creating metal surfaces

This is just a couple of things I keep in mind when creating metal surfaces. They are by no means set in stone, it's just a few things I've noticed might help when creating metal surfaces for next (well, current really) gen use.

The most common problem with normalmaps for metal is that it's easy to overdo it. Depending on the engine you are using, you might not be able to get sharp, crisp normalmaps unless you use fairly large texture sheets so for the most part, the fine grainy detail will have to be left to the specular. Scratches and such do work however and usually need to be in the normalmap to make it look convincing (just keep in mind that texture compression might ruin the really fine scratches, those that are just one or two pixels wide).

Below is a compilation of different types of painted metal surfaces:



As you can see, painted metal can look very different depending on what type of paint it is and what it has been subjected to. It's important to decide what type of paint your surface has been painted with since it will affect both the normal and the specular maps. Having a history in mind when you create the textures is useful since it will help you decide how to treat it. Is it an old surface with lots of scratches, new with a few dents, so old the paint has started to flake, was it painted without being cleaned up first so you have really lumpy paint, has it been polished often? Having a history will also make the object look a bit more interesting rather than "generic metal box #6". This is of course not mandatory, it's just a mental exercise that might help when creating the textures. I should add that having a history in mind works for any kind of texturing, not just metal surfaces.

A common mistake is to create a normalmap that has a lot of noise in it but this makes the surface look more like leather/elephant hide than metal. If the texture is a 2048 instead of say, a 1024, the noise might have looked more like the grainy paint above but in most cases, it won't look like convincing metal. What I would do is to tone the noise down considerably and just keep the scratches where the paint has been scratched away to reveal the metal. What we need to keep in mind however, is that scratches that are just a few pixels wide will most likely look lumpy and not very pretty once the texure has been compressed. So keep larger scrathes, dents etc in the normalmap but be careful with the finer detail.

In addition to that, a specular with fairly high contrast can work well since paint is usually fairly matte and non-reflective (there are of course exceptions, it is as always down to what type of surface you want to mimic) whereas scratches can be very shiny since the metal surface beneath the paint shows through. Another little tweak can be to make the diffuse colder. Sometimes a texture can have a fairly warm feel, with brown and almost light orange tones as a base which can make it feel slightly wooden. By simply changing the hue on the base colour layers so they are more blue-tinted it can feel more metal-y. It's a cheap trick but it works. It is also important to tweak the specular curve of your material since the way a game engine renders the light shining on your material can have a large impact in addition to your textures.

When it comes to the specular, it's almost better to put a lot of the fine detail there rather than in the normalmap for the reasons outlined above. Some detail needs to be in the normalmap and mimicked in the specularmap, such as scratches while otheres shouldn't be in the specular at all. One such example is if you have a plain metal surface that has been dented. Again, this depends on what kind of effect you want. If it's a recent dent, there won't have been time for dirt and dust to collect so it hasn't become dull yet. If it's an old dent, it will be less shiny than the surrounding areas since it won't have been cleaned as well as the rest of the surface. And just to add to the confusion, some things should be in the specular but not the normalmap such as oily surfaces, grease marks, handprints etc. This is where the idea of having a history of the objects comes in handy again. Has the object been manhandled a lot, dropped, left to stand in an oilslick etc. All these things combine to make the surface look interesting and if you put the right detail in the right map, it will look fantastic.

Of course, metals need to reflect something so having a good reflection map is the last piece of the puzzle. Here is where it can come down more to what looks good than what it would realistically reflect. Unless your surface is very clean you can get away with using a reflection that doesn't have anything to do with the setting. As long as it looks good, that's all that matters. It's also down to memory usage. If you take a cubemap for example, it's made from six separate images so the memory usage is fairly large for just a single cubemap. If you can reuse one cubemap on many surfaces you'll save memory which can then be spent on other things, such as higher resolution textures on selected objects. As always it's a trade off between what looks good and how much memory you have left for the shiny stuff. That's also why slightly dirty, painted metals is a bit easier to cheat with, you won't get a clear image of what the reflection looks like. Clean environments are always harder to get to look good and interesting in my opinion. Attitude and Criticism

One thing you will face as an artist in the games industry is criticism. It's unavoidable. Your co-workers will tear your work apart, your leads will tear your work apart and your art director will tear your work apart. Maybe not devastatingly so, but they will still find things you can improve and undoubtedly you will be told to change things. So the right attitude is pretty important, on both sides if you want to keep the artists at least civil with eachother. Giving and being able to take criticism is probably one of the most important skills to have in order to stay moderately sane when working in this industry since you are working with a group of creative people who (hopefully) want to create the best looking game that they can.

In order to do so we try to help and push eachother to new heights and there will inevitably be occasions when someone will look at your screen and, depending on their social skills, say anything from "That's shit" to "Looks good, but you could chage that bit to this and this bit here to that, could be cool" to "The publisher has changed the date, we need to cut this down". That last one is especially fun. What I'm getting at is that no piece of work survives contact with your co-workers so being able to distance yourself from your work is very important. I'm not saying don't be passionate about what you are doing, you have to be if you want to be good but don't let your work equal your self esteem. I've seen a lot of young (and not so young) artists starting out and as soon as someone points out a flaw get very defensive and try to fob it off with "It's supposed to look like that, his nose was grafted on after a dog bit it off and the doctor was a cross-eyed drunk with parkinsons so he couldn't do it very well so that's why the nose looks like that, be quiet". Which isn't really helping anyone. Of course, you don't have to rely on your co-workers since there are a few simple ways to check your own work. One of them is to just mirror whatever you're working on, either in your tools or by looking at it in a mirror. After a while your brain gets used to the way things are placed in relation to eachother so flipping it will force your brain to re-evaluate the image, helping you spot flaws or maybe if you nudge that bit there a bit to the left it will look even better. Or you can flip it upside down. Another way is to play with colourschemes, again forcing your brain to refresh.

Being able to look at your work with critical eyes and a bit of distance is going to help you in the long run and make you a better artist. Being able to look at other peoples work and point out things that could be better in a nice way is also something that will help you in the long run, especially on the social side. As an example, CGTalk has battled with this for some time, on how to get people to give constructive criticism instead of the usual "AWESOME!!!11" and "That's shit!" and it's just as important, if not more so in a studio. You don't want your co-workers seeing you as an obnoxious idiot so when commenting on peoples work it's a good idea to articulate why something is great/shit and what could change. Preferably at the same time. Criticism is usually absorbed a bit easier if you point out something that is good at the same time as you point out something that is bad. Of course, once you get to know the poeple you work with you will know who you can walk up to and say "Jesus, what the hell did you do to that?!" and have a laugh and who is a bit more sensitive about their work where a more diplomatic approach is needed. I'm not saying you have to be overly nice about it but you do need to be honest. If you give honest criticism and explain why and perhaps think of a few ways it can be improved, people will (hopefully) appreciate it more. When you ask for advice they will hopefully treat you the same way since that is the best way to improve. Being nice to someone can actually do more damage than good in some cases. Tell the truth, but do it in a polite way and you get the best of both worlds. There's no need to put someone down just because they made a mistake, that is not constructive and will only generate ill will which might come back and bite you later.

Speaking of attitudes, having an open mind towards new techniques, tools and programs is really important in my opinion. In this industry the technology is always evolving and there's almost always something new popping up that looks cool and interesting so to dismiss it wihtout giving it a look seems counterproductive to me. On one hand it's easy to get stuck in your ways and not really try to evolve ("it works for me and I'm happy with it") which isn't necessarily a bad thing in itself but it does mean you can get left behind in a way. Take the not so recent transition where we started to use normalmaps. It's been used in games for at least 4-5 years by now but there are still games where the normalmaps are a mess. Wether this is due to lack of knowledge or lack of passion, the result is the same, it looks like crap. Having an interest in learning and sharing the knowledge is as much as anyone can do since you can't actually force anyone to learn new stuff unless they want to (well if you're the lead/AD you can force them...) and it will show that you're trying to improve both yourself and the general quality of work which you will hopefully be encouraged to. There are of course places where this isn't appreciated or might even be actively discouraged but you can't win all the time.

In conclusion, being able to give constructive criticism is very important as is being able to take it on board. Having an attitude of "I'm the greatest thing since sliced bread!" and ignoring what your co-workers are saying isn't going to do you any favours. Being open to knowledge no matter the source and being willing to share is the way to go. This might be a bit obvious to you but from what I've seen and heard, it really isn't that apparent to people that we are evolving as an industry every day, every week. New tools, new ideas and new processes will always come along and complement the old ways. Being able to seize on these and bend them to your will is not a bad thing and it saddens me when people treat them with suspicion. Don't fear the change!

-Day after posting edit-

I remembered a few other ways to refresh your brain in regards to your own work. Taking a break if you can is a good way (look at this addendum as an example). A coffee break or ever better, a day or two without looking at it will make you come back to it and see it in a new light. Of course, in the games industry you are usually working to deadlines so being able to leave something alone for a day or two isn't always possible. If you're working on a texture, taking a step back and unfocusing your eyes will draw your attention to areas that stand out. If you're doing a 3d model, assigning it a completely black material will allow you to focus on the silhouette, making it easier to see how your model reads from a distance without any detail to distract the eyes. Team Fortress 2 is worth noting in this since each of the nine classes have distinctly different silhouettes. You can spot which class you're up against from a mile off thanks to the excellent character design. Consistency and Efficiency

One of the problems when creating environments (and any kind of assets really) is to keep things consistent, especially if you have more than one person working on a project. When I say consistency I mean the general feel and design of a scene, level or asset. Texturing, lighting, modeling, shading and all the other little bits that go in to creating these little works. The reason for this post is a question I got asked on CgTalk and it's an intersting one since in theory it should be quite simple, especially if it's just one person doing the creating. However, in reality it isn't always so easy, especially as your team grows.

For the single artist working on a scene it is usually fairly straight forward to keep things consistent since it's just you and you have your own workflow. But even then you tend to develop your techniques as you go along which can introduce slight inconsistencies in your work. For example, take a project I've been working on for some time, a 2d shooter. I started out with one style in mind and created a few ships along the guidelines I had set myself. However, after a couple of ships, the style started changing as I tried new ideas and approaches. After a month or so, the new ships looked nothing like the old ones which led to more work since I had to redo the old assets. This is of course my own fault since I could've stuck with the original style but truth be told, it didn't really work so it was a good thing the style changed.

So where am I going with this? The importance of concepts and style studies/guides can never be overestimated. Had I done proper concepting and tried out various styles in the beginning I might not have had to redo those ships. The fact that it is 2d doesn't really matter since the same principle applies to 3d as well. It's easy to get excited when you have an idea and just get stuck in with the modeling but what might happen is that you start to flounder a bit later on when the intial idea has been brewing in your head for a while. It starts to change and you might think of new things to add. Slowly your intital idea will evolve into something else and that's can of course be a good thing. But it's usually a bit more efficient to do this evolving on the concept stage since it's a lot faster to do simple drawings instead of modeling an environment. And realising halfway through that you're not sure where you are going or that the first part you made doesn't actually fit with where you're going now can be really frustrating and in the worst case mean that you just drop it.

The same idea is even more important when you have a group of people working together on environments or a bunch of assets. Having concepts that you can refer to, quick mood paintings with colour schemes, detail studies to show the more intricate parts and surface types is worth its weight in gold. And to bring it all together, a Lead Artist or for larger teams an Art Director that can guide the rest of the team towards a common style. The Lead or AD needs to have a vision of how the different parts will come together and be able to guide the rest of the team towards that vision because if they don't, our personal styles will undoubtedly start to make their mark on the stuff we produce and you'll get a disjointed feeling to the visuals. Some parts might look a bit like, say, Call of Duty whereas another part might look more like Killzone or Half Life 2. I'm not advocating that a Lead should walk around with a whip, forcing each artist to obey his every whim but rather that the Lead/AD will keep an eye on what is produced so they can step in and nudge people in the right direction before it would have to be completely redone. Especially before things are commited as a final version in your source control there needs to be some sort of sign off.
